Whether or not you have the iPhone/Pad or a Droid, app stores are carrying bigger and better games. One of the newest games for iPhone/iPad, Eternal Legacy, comes from the GameLoft studio.

Eternal Legacy is a Japanese-style RPG which looks like any Final Fantasy or game with the tag lines: “Honor,” “Kingdom,” “Magic Missile,” or “Britney Spears” in it (Hikaru Utada for you weeaboos). The game OBVIOUSLY has brilliant writing - “We mean you no harm, I am a Guardian.” My first impression from this teaser is that, visually, it’s very impressive for an app game. You can explore what looks to be big maps, the characters are colorful enough to keep my interest, and that’s it.
